How To Fix WBBY405 - Material grouping break down: promotion & does not exist


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WBBY - Bonus Buys / Material Grouping

  • Message number: 405

  • Message text: Material grouping break down: promotion & does not exist

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message WBBY405 - Material grouping break down: promotion & does not exist ?

    The SAP error message WBBY405 indicates that there is an issue with the material grouping breakdown for a promotion in the SAP system. This error typically arises in the context of sales and distribution, particularly when dealing with promotions and pricing.

    Cause:

    The error message "Material grouping breakdown: promotion & does not exist" usually occurs due to one of the following reasons:

    1. Missing Promotion Data: The promotion that you are trying to access or process does not exist in the system. This could be due to incorrect promotion codes or the promotion not being set up properly in the system.

    2. Incorrect Material Grouping: The material grouping associated with the promotion may not be defined correctly or may not exist in the system.

    3.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the pricing or promotion setup in SAP, leading to the system not recognizing the promotion.

    4. Data Inconsistencies: There could be inconsistencies in the master data related to materials or promotions, such as missing or incorrect entries.

    Solution:

    To resolve the WBBY405 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Promotion Setup:

      • Verify that the promotion you are trying to use is correctly set up in the system. Check the promotion code and ensure it exists in the promotion master data.
    2. Review Material Grouping:

      • Ensure that the material grouping associated with the promotion is defined and exists in the system. You can check this in the material master data.
    3. Configuration Review:

      • Review the configuration settings related to promotions and pricing in SAP.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ly configured.
    4. Data Consistency Check:

      • Perform a data consistency check to identify any discrepancies in the master data. This may involve checking the material master, promotion master, and any related tables.
